What is a Robotic Hoover?

Robotic hoovers, commonly known as  robotic vacuum cleaner s, are compact, automatic gadgets designed to tidy floors with very little human intervention. They utilize various technologies to browse around obstacles, detect dirt, and adapt to different surface areas for optimum cleaning.

How Do Robotic Hoovers Work?

Robotic hoovers overcome a combination of sensors, cams, and expert system to browse and clean floorings. Here's a general summary of their operation:

  1. Mapping and Navigation: Some advanced designs use LiDAR technology or video cameras to develop a map of the cleaning locations. Standard models may operate utilizing bump sensors, which trigger responses upon contact with obstacles.
  2. Cleaning Patterns: Robotic hoovers often follow methodical cleaning patterns, such as zigzag or spiral, to make sure thorough protection. More sophisticated ones utilize algorithms to cover the whole location efficiently.
  3. Dirt Detection: Many models are geared up with dirt detection technology that enables them to focus on particularly dirty locations before proceeding.
  4. Automatic Recharge: When the battery is running low, robotic hoovers automatically go back to their docking stations to recharge, guaranteeing they are always ready for the next cleaning cycle.

Benefits of Robotic Hoovers

Enhanced benefit is a leading benefit of robotic hoovers, however there are many other advantages worth considering:

  • Time-Saving: Users can set cleaning schedules and leave the device to do its work, permitting them to concentrate on other tasks.
  • Consistent Cleaning: Robotic hoovers can maintain daily or weekly cleaning routines, leading to consistently cleaner floorings.
  • Multi-Surface Cleaning: Many models are capable of cleaning a variety of surfaces, including hardwood, tile, and carpet.
  • Compact Design: The little size of robotic hoovers permits them to access tight and hard-to-reach areas where conventional vacuums may struggle.
  • Smart Features: Many robotic hoovers are now suitable with wise home systems, permitting users to start and manage cleaning through smartphone apps or voice commands.

Disadvantages of Robotic Hoovers

Regardless of their many advantages, robotic hoovers also come with some disadvantages that potential purchasers need to keep in mind:

  • Limited Suction Power: While they are effective for regular upkeep, they may not change traditional vacuums for deep cleaning.
  • Upkeep Requirements: Users require to frequently empty dust bins, clean brushes, and alter filters to keep optimal efficiency.
  • Price Point: High-quality robotic hoovers can be considerably more expensive than standard vacuum.
  • Dependence on Flat Surfaces: While sophisticated models can handle some challenges, steep shifts, excessively thick carpets, or cluttered rooms might present challenges.

FAQ Section

Q1: Do robotic hoovers deal with carpets?

Yes, the majority of robotic hoovers are designed to clean a variety of surface areas, consisting of carpets. However, performance may vary based on the specific design and type of carpet.

Q2: How often should I run my robotic hoover?

It is advised to run the robotic hoover at least when a week for optimal home cleanliness. However, lots of users discover worth in day-to-day cleaning.

Q3: Can I manage my robotic hoover from another location?

Many modern robotic hoovers come with accompanying mobile phone apps that permit users to set up cleanings, track the vacuum's location, and control its operations remotely.

Q4: What maintenance does a robotic hoover require?

Regular maintenance consists of clearing the dustbin, cleaning brushes, and changing filters as required-- generally every 6 to 12 months.

Q5: Are robotic hoovers safe for family pets?

Yes, the majority of robotic hoovers are safe for animals, however it's essential to ensure they do not get stuck or tangled in the gadget.
